Genocide and the Global Village K. Campbell
Genocide and the Global Village
K. Campbell
Campbell engages in a complex, multi-level analysis of genocide's impact upon world order, and the inter-play of politics and morality in the international community's determination of the appropriate role for military force in halting genocide and securing an emerging global civil society.
